/***************************************************************************/ |
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
* update_vector_checksum |
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
* The algorithim is to write the checksum such that the checksum of the |
|
|
|
* first 8 words is equal to zero. |
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
* The LPC1768 uses little-endian, and this particular routine assumes |
|
|
|
* that it's running on a little-endian architecture. |
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
static int update_vector_checksum( const char *filename ) |
|
|
|
{ |
|
|
|
uint32_t sum; |
|
|
|
uint32_t header[8]; |
|
|
|
FILE *fs; |
|
|
|
int i; |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
if (( fs = fopen( filename, "r+b" )) == NULL ) |
|
|
|
{ |
|
|
|
fprintf( stderr, "Unable to open '%s' for reading/writing (%d): %s\n", |
|
|
|
filename, errno, strerror( errno )); |
|
|
|
return 0; |
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
if ( fread( header, sizeof( header ), 1, fs ) != 1 ) |
|
|
|
{ |
|
|
|
fprintf( stderr, "Failed to read header from '%s' (perhaps the file is too small?)", |
|
|
|
filename ); |
|
|
|
fclose( fs ); |
|
|
|
return 0; |
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
sum = 0; |
|
|
|
for ( i = 0; i < 7; i++ ) |
|
|
|
{ |
|
|
|
sum += header[i]; |
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
printf( "sum = 0x%08x, value to write = 0x%08x\n", sum, -sum ); |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/* write back the checksum to location 7 |
|
|
|
* http://sigalrm.blogspot.jp/2011/10/cortex-m3-exception-vector-checksum.html |
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
fseek(fs, 0x1c, SEEK_SET); |
|
|
|
sum = -sum; |
|
|
|
fwrite(&sum, 4, 1, fs); |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
fclose( fs ); |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
return 1; |
|
|
|
} |
